SKIN CARE WITH NATURAL HOME REMEDIES

Follow these simple remedies to have a healthy and fresh skin

Healthy skin is not only a reflection of what’s on the outside but what’s on the inside. Incorporating certain practices and lifestyle habits into your daily routine can help you achieve healthy and glowing skin. Here are some tips to help you get started.

Firstly, coconut oil is a versatile and natural remedy that has many benefits. It contains anti-inflammatory, antioxidant and healing properties that can soothe and moisturize your skin. However, before you start using coconut oil on your face, ensure that you don’t have an allergy to it. Once you’re certain, apply a small amount of coconut oil on your face before washing it off with a cleanser. This can help moisturize your skin and give it a healthy glow.

Secondly, aloe vera is another natural ingredient that can benefit your skin. It has healing properties and can soothe and moisturize your skin without clogging your pores. To test whether you’re allergic to it, rub a small amount on your forearm and wait for a reaction. If there’s none, you can use it on your face to keep your skin strong and healthy.

Thirdly, moisturizing your skin after washing your face is essential. Use products that lock in moisture, promote healing and have antioxidant properties. Don’t skip moisturizer just because your face feels oily or exfoliate when it feels dry. Apply moisturizer to your skin while it’s still wet to lock in extra moisture and make your face feel smooth.

Fourthly, wearing sunscreen every day is essential to prevent skin cancer and photoaging. Apply a product with an SPF of 15 or higher every morning, even on cloudy or rainy days.

Fifthly, find a cleansing routine that works for your skin type. Don’t wash your face too often as it can rob your skin of moisture, and don’t encourage your pores to produce too much extra oil by washing it too little. Washing your face after working up a sweat, first thing in the morning, and right before bed is ideal for healthy skin.

Sixthly, avoid smoke and second-hand smoke as they can prematurely age your skin. If you smoke, quitting is the best way to help your skin look healthier.

Seventhly, drinking enough water can help your skin function well. Aim for at least eight 8-ounce glasses of water per day.

Eighthly, nourish your skin by eating a diet that’s rich in fruits and vegetables. This will boost the vitamins and antioxidants in your body, promoting healthier-looking skin.

Lastly, shorten your shower time as exposing your skin to hot water for extended periods can strip it of its natural oils. Cooling down the temperature in the latter part of your shower can improve circulation, which may give your face a more toned and youthful appearance.
